What You’ll Do :

  • Manage project tasks including hardware and panel design, PLC and HMI programming, SCADA design, power distribution design, and all associated project documentation.
  • Manage project execution including proposal preparation, estimating, scheduling, resources, staffing, contract negotiation, order processing, quality control, customer satisfaction, and project set-up.

What You’ll Bring :

  • A minimum of ten years of experience in developing and providing automation solutions for the consumer products or industrial design industries.
  • Experience designing electrical control systems and programming automation systems for process applications.
  • Proficiency in Rockwell hardware and software solutions.
  • Experience with Siemens, Wonderware, and GE software / hardware (preferred).
  • Experience in food & beverage, pulp & paper, or other industrial industries (preferred).
  • Solid communication and interpersonal skills, and the ability to interact with all levels of management, clients, and vendors.
  • A willingness to travel for project requirements including installation and start-up activities, client and company sponsored meetings, trainings, industry related seminars, forums, and conventions.
  • A bachelor of science in electrical engineering is preferred, but consideration will be given to other engineering degrees based on relevant experience.
